2004 Ford Crown Victoria vs. 1977 Ford LTD

To start off, 2004 Ford Crown Victoria is newer by 27 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1977 Ford LTD.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1977 Ford LTD would be higher. At 5,763 cc (8 cylinders), 1977 Ford LTD is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1977 Ford LTD (296 HP @ 5400 RPM) has 57 more horse power than 2004 Ford Crown Victoria. (239 HP @ 5750 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1977 Ford LTD should accelerate faster than 2004 Ford Crown Victoria.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Ford Crown Victoria weights approximately 50 kg more than 1977 Ford LTD.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1977 Ford LTD (525 Nm) has 151 more torque (in Nm) than 2004 Ford Crown Victoria. (374 Nm). This means 1977 Ford LTD will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2004 Ford Crown Victoria.
